Investigation Summary

Investigation Nr: 200074953
Event: 03/20/2012
Baler Machine Cathes Fire and Burns Worker

On March 30, 2012, Employee #1, 40 year-old male baler machine operator with Carolina Precision Fibers Inc., received a second degree burns due to fire/explosion while working a cuber (baler machine) on production line #1. A mulch product was being produced from cellulose fibers at the time of the fire/explosion. Employee #1 was hospitalized as a result of this event.

Keywords: BURN, DUST, FIRE, EXPLOSION, BALER
